Wilkinson slm are delighted to present to market, with no onward chain and offering fantastic potential, this three bedroom mid terraced home in need of modernisation. Having been lovingly owned by the same family for over 50 years, this home is now ready for its next chapter-offering an exciting opportunity for buyers to create a home truly tailored to their own tastes and style.
Upon entering, the front door opens into a hallway. To the right, you’ll find a lounge featuring a gas fireplace. A large opening leads through to the dining room, where sliding doors provide direct access to the rear garden.
From the dining room, a door leads into the kitchen, which is fitted with a range of base and wall units. Additional doors provide access back to the hallway, a spacious utility room and a separate downstairs WC. Both the kitchen and utility room offer space and plumbing for appliances, with the utility room also benefiting from its own external front access. A further side door, accessed via the WC, leads out to the rear garden.
The southerly facing rear garden is a true highlight enjoying an abundance of natural sunlight throughout they day. Immediately adjoining the house is a patio area and beyond, the garden is mainly laid to lawn. A garden shed provides useful storage, while the boards are planted with a variety of established plants, flowers and shrubs creating a colourful and attractive setting.
Stairs rise from the hallway to the first floor, where you will find three well-proportioned double bedrooms. The accommodation is completed by a family bathroom, a separate WC, and a useful storage cupboard.
Additional benefits include gas central heating, double glazing and a charming front garden that adds to the home’s kerb appeal.
